Abstract
A pressbrake is a machine used to bend metal sheet at different angles in a metal fabrication factory. High degree of bending angle accuracy and productivity are main objectives for having computerised numerical control (CNC) on such machines. The objective of this paper is to describe the fuzzy logic controller developed for hydraulic pressbrake. This system is shown to be multi-input multi-output (MIMO) system, the control parameters being speed, force and positions. To use the fuzzy logic rule base, the architecture of fuzzy controller is divided into eight different MISO systems. A novel approach to solve practical problems of excessive jerks and variation due to environmental conditions is described here. Standard techniques are used for fuzzification and defuzzification. This control strategy is shown to be superior than the existing conventional one
